Runbook — Brimshaw broker upgrade (on-call). Drain consumers on the secondary cluster first; wait for queue depth under 100 before stopping the broker service. Apply the package upgrade, then restart with the staged config, not the live one. Verify replication catches up within five minutes; if not, roll back using the snapshot taken in step one. Confirm dashboards show green before re-enabling producers. Record the upgraded broker build, shown below.

pipeline stamp: htk3_cc5

Attendees reviewed the proposal to expand into the Vessmark region, beginning with two pilot branches in Odenlow and Carrithe. Site surveys are complete, and lease negotiations proceed through local agents. Staffing plans call for internal transfers supplemented by regional hiring in the spring. Branch managers were asked to nominate candidates for transfer by the end of the month. Marketing timelines remain under discussion. The confidential note on underlying business plans is appended below.

board note of bawep-tajef: Queniusek Systems plans to raise the Quenvan list price by 53.1 percent in March. The pricing group signed off on a budget of $176.4 million for Project Drueth. The renewal with Casionix Partners closes at $142.5 million a year, 8.3 percent below the last contract. Project Fraax slips by six weeks because of the tooling delay.

**Vendor note: Inkmill markdown pipeline**

Rendering for Parchway docs is outsourced to Inkmill under an annual contract, renewing each March. They handle sanitization and PDF export; we own the upload queue. SLA: 4-hour response on rendering failures. Escalate only after two failed retries. Their support desk is reachable at the address below.

billing contact of hahaf-baguf = zorael.tammir.jorius@sivrelhq.internal

## Service accounts: Bigdiff

Bigdiff renders diffs for files over 50MB by streaming chunks from the Marrowvale blob store. It runs under the `svc-bigdiff` account; no human should use it interactively. Permissions: read-only on blobs, write on the render cache. Rotation is quarterly, handled by the Penhallow team. If chunk fetches 403, the key expired early — rotate, don't extend. Current key for `svc-bigdiff` follows.

API key for fahif-bahop: vxb23-B1zKyQaAnaG4Gma9WuizPfB